This paper studies the pricing effect of that delay. When collateral remains locked until oracle settlement, a near-certain dollar is a delayed dollar, so prices embed a maturity-dependent settlement discount in addition to beliefs about outcomes. We recover an implied settlement-discount term structure from persistent near-certain contracts using realized settlement times and summarize it as an annualized settlement wedge (ASW).
